Hi all,

I was hoping this would be corrected in Onyx but it appears that when creating a new subscription the default documents still default to having the first letter capitalised.

For Example:
Index.php
Index.html
Index.asp

For programming reasons we have to manually change these document filenames to lowercase on every subscription we add.

Is there a way the default documents can be changes to lowercase as default? Where do these initial values get stored?

I know there's a SQL query on a KB article that will change any existing subscriptions virtual hosts to whatever you specify but that's not really what I'm looking for.
